Output e2494c21535d35a065e03ff045b77caa8b6a08f0700595fc5a26ed4990f9de29:0

value
150544943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59c43fd5e7d436115a04b8e7a6df5981b8c1d032 OP_EQUAL
address
39sfAG6Xxj85i7iJrrvFaFjf6bE7V1rCaU
transaction
e2494c21535d35a065e03ff045b77caa8b6a08f0700595fc5a26ed4990f9de29
spent
true